The SCLogin module has an option for how the buttons should display. Set them as text links. Then, you'll need to do some integration with CSS to make it fit into your template's styles. Each template is different, so we don't have a method to make it work with all templates, unfortunately.

The "My Account" menu is a Bootstrap dropdown menu. I believe there's one minor code edit that we make to get it to drop down on hover on our site. I can look that up for you, but the first step is to get the text links from the login module integrated/styled properly first.

i want change this line "/" between login and register to "|" , how can i make it please ?

The SCLogin module uses standard Joomla language files. Please edit the mod_sclogin.ini file in the language folder to change the separator.
